ArtSource Colorado
Offered through the Colorado Art Education Association, an
annual visual art education and leadership training institute which
seeks "to promote excellence, foster innovation, and develop
leadership for art in education."

Lincoln Center Institute for the Arts in Education, New York
The Lincoln
Center Institute was founded in 1975 to create a new approach to arts
and education that would make the arts integral to learning. Far more
than traditional arts appreciation, the Institute's practice is rooted
in collaboration between artists and teachers that provides students
with hands-on opportunities to explore and understand the arts. Students
see live performances and engage in creative and analytical exploration
that, in turn, supports learning across the curriculum.

Cultural Arts Resources for Teachers and Students
Funded by the National Endowment for
the Arts, the National Network for Folk Arts in Education advocates for the inclusion of folk and traditional arts
and culture in the nation’s education. Training
opportunities for K-12 educators in folk arts, folklife, and oral
history can be found at http://www.carts.org/.
